<?xml version="1.0" encoding="UTF-8"?>
<!DOCTYPE article PUBLIC "-//NLM//DTD JATS (Z39.96) Journal Publishing DTD v1.3 20210610//EN" "JATS-journalpublishing1-3.dtd">
<article article-type="research-article" dtd-version="1.3" xmlns:mml="http://www.w3.org/1998/Math/MathML" xmlns:xlink="http://www.w3.org/1999/xlink"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ance" xml:lang="ru"><front><journal-meta><journal-id journal-id-type="publisher-id">inform</journal-id><journal-title-group><journal-title xml:lang="ru">Информатика</journal-title><trans-title-group xml:lang="en"><trans-title>Informatics</trans-title></trans-title-group></journal-title-group><issn pub-type="ppub">1816-0301</issn><issn pub-type="epub">2617-6963</issn><publisher><publisher-name>UIIP NASB</publisher-name></publisher></journal-meta><article-meta><article-id pub-id-type="doi">10.37661/1816-0301-2022-19-4-84-93</article-id><article-id custom-type="elpub" pub-id-type="custom">inform-1210</article-id><article-categories><subj-group subj-group-type="heading"><subject>Research Article</subject></subj-group><subj-group subj-group-type="section-heading" xml:lang="ru"><subject>ИНФОРМАЦИОННЫЕ ТЕХНОЛОГИИ</subject></subj-group><subj-group subj-group-type="section-heading" xml:lang="en"><subject>INFORMATION TECHNOLOGY</subject></subj-group></article-categories><title-group><article-title>Модель балансировки нагрузки кластерной системы с учетом аппаратных характеристик серверного оборудования</article-title><trans-title-group xml:lang="en"><trans-title>Cluster system load balancing model with consideration of hardware characteristics of server hardware</trans-title></trans-title-group></title-group><contrib-group><contrib contrib-type="author" corresp="yes"><contrib-id contrib-id-type="orcid">https://orcid.org/0000-0001-8508-1812</contrib-id><name-alternatives><name name-style="eastern" xml:lang="ru"><surname>Марков</surname><given-names>А. Н.</given-names></name><name name-style="western" xml:lang="en"><surname>Markov</surname><given-names>A. N.</given-names></name></name-alternatives><bio xml:lang="ru"><p>Марков Алексей Николаевич, аспирант, заместитель начальника Центра информатизации и инновационных разработок</p><p>ул. Платонова, 39, Минск, 220013</p></bio><bio xml:lang="en"><p>Aleksey N. Markov, Postgraduate Student, Deputy Head of the Center for Informatization and Innovative Development</p><p>st. Platonova, 39, Minsk, 220013</p></bio><email xlink:type="simple">a.n.markov@bsuir.by</email><xref ref-type="aff" rid="aff-1"/></contrib></contrib-group><aff-alternatives id="aff-1"><aff xml:lang="ru"><institution>Центр информатизации и инновационных разработок Белорусского государственного  университета информатики и радиоэлектроники</institution></aff><aff xml:lang="en"><institution>Center for Informatization and Innovation Development of the Belarusian State University of Informatics and Radioelectronics</institution></aff></aff-alternatives><pub-date pub-type="collection"><year>2022</year></pub-date><pub-date pub-type="epub"><day>22</day><month>08</month><year>2022</year></pub-date><volume>19</volume><issue>4</issue><fpage>84</fpage><lpage>93</lpage><permissions><copyright-statement>Copyright &amp;#x00A9; Марков А.Н., 2022</copyright-statement><copyright-year>2022</copyright-year><copyright-holder xml:lang="ru">Марков А.Н.</copyright-holder><copyright-holder xml:lang="en">Markov A.N.</copyright-holder><license xml:lang="ru" license-type="creative-commons-attribution" xlink:href="https://creativecommons.org/licenses/by/4.0/" xlink:type="simple"><license-p>Данная работа распространяется под лицензией Creative Commons Attribution 4.0.</license-p></license><license xml:lang="en" license-type="creative-commons-attribution" xlink:href="https://creativecommons.org/licenses/by/4.0/" xlink:type="simple"><license-p>This work is licensed under a Creative Commons Attribution 4.0 License.</license-p></license></permissions><self-uri xlink:href="https://inf.grid.by/jour/article/view/1210">https://inf.grid.by/jour/article/view/1210</self-uri><abstract><p>Цели. Поставлены цели модернизировать и дополнить существующую модель балансировки нагрузки в многосерверных системах с учетом аппаратных характеристик серверного оборудования, а также его наиболее загруженных компонентов в кластере сервиса видео-конференц-связи при использовании в образовательных процессах и организации дистанционной формы образования.Методы. Существующая математическая модель балансировки нагрузки рассмотрена как система массового обслуживания, в которой вводятся штрафы за простой оборудования, а штрафы за ожидание в очереди будут зависеть от загруженности аппаратных компонентов серверов в кластерной архитектуре сервиса видео-конференц-связи.Результаты. Приведены формулы для вычисления суммарной производительности кластера из n серверов при максимальной и минимальной загрузках аппаратных компонентов серверов в кластере системы видео-конференц-связи.Заключение. Разработан моделирующий комплекс для проверки математической модели на системе до n &lt; 10 серверов в кластере системы видео-конференц-связи. По результатам вычислений моделирующего комплекса сделан вывод о необходимости доработки существующего алгоритма балансировки нагрузки на выбранный сервис видео-конференц-связи BigBlueButton.</p></abstract><trans-abstract xml:lang="en"><p>Objectives. To upgrade and complement the existing load balancing model in multi-server systems, taking into account the hardware characteristics of the server equipment, as well as the most loaded components of the server equipment in the video conferencing service cluster in educational processes and distance education.Methods. The existing mathematical model of load balancing as a mass exchange system is considered, when significant changes are introduced: penalties for equipment downtime and penalties for waiting in a queue will depend on the load on the server hardware components in the cluster architecture of video conferencing service.Results. Formulas are given for calculating the total performance of a cluster of n servers with the maximum and minimum load of server hardware components in a videoconferencing system cluster.Conclusion. A modeling complex has been developed to test the mathematical model on a system of up to n &lt; 10 servers in a cluster of a videoconferencing system. Based on the results of calculations of the modeling complex, it was concluded that it is necessary to upgrate the existing algorithm for balancing the load on the selected BigBlueButton video conferencing service.</p></trans-abstract><kwd-group xml:lang="ru"><kwd>видео-конференц-связь</kwd><kwd>сервис BigBlueButton</kwd><kwd>балансировка нагрузки в кластере</kwd><kwd>математическая модель балансировки</kwd><kwd>дистанционное образование</kwd></kwd-group><kwd-group xml:lang="en"><kwd>video conferencing</kwd><kwd>service BigBlueButton</kwd><kwd>load balancing in a cluster</kwd><kwd>mathematical model of load balancing</kwd><kwd>distance education</kwd></kwd-group></article-meta></front><back><ref-list><title>References</title><ref id="cit1"><label>1</label><citation-alternatives><mixed-citation xml:lang="ru">Парамонов, А. И. Проблемы дистанционного образования и их прикладные решения в образовательных технологиях / А. И. Парамонов // Высшее техническое образование: проблемы и пути развития = Engineering education: challendes and developments : материалы Х Междунар. науч.-метод. конф., Минск, 26 нояб. 2020 г. – Минск : БГУИР, 2020. – С. 182–187.</mixed-citation><mixed-citation xml:lang="en">Paramonov A. I. Distance education problems and their applied solutions in educational technologies. Vysshee tehnicheskoe obrazovanie: problemy i puti razvitija : materialy Х Mezhdunarodnoj nauchnometodicheskoj konferencii, Minsk, 26 nojabrja 2020 g. [Engineering Education: Challendes and Developments : Materials of the X International Scientific and Methodological Conference, Minsk, 26 November 2020]. Minsk, Belorusskij gosudarstvennyj universitet informatiki i radiojelektroniki, 2020, рр. 182–187 (In Russ.).</mixed-citation></citation-alternatives></ref><ref id="cit2"><label>2</label><citation-alternatives><mixed-citation xml:lang="ru">Марков, А. Н. Готовность учреждений высшего образования к цифровой трансформации процессов / А. Н. Марков, С. А. Мигалевич // Цифровая трансформация. – 2021. – № 2. – С. 64– 68.</mixed-citation><mixed-citation xml:lang="en">Markov A. N., Migalevich S. A. Readiness of higher education institutions for digital transformation processes. Cifrovaja transformacija [Digital Transformation], 2021, no. 2, рр. 64–68 (In Russ.).</mixed-citation></citation-alternatives></ref><ref id="cit3"><label>3</label><citation-alternatives><mixed-citation xml:lang="ru">Марков, А. Н. Выбор сервиса видео-конференц-связи и его адаптация под учреждение образования / А. Н. Марков, Р. О. Игнатович, А. И. Парамонов // Информатика. – 2021. – Т. 18, № 4. – С. 17–25. https://doi.org/10.37661/1816-0301-2021-18-4-17-25</mixed-citation><mixed-citation xml:lang="en">Markov A. N., Ihnatovich R. O., Paramonov A. I. Choosing a video conferencing service and its adaptation for educational institution. Informatika [Informatics], 2021, vol. 18, no. 4, рр. 17–25 (In Russ.). https://doi.org/10.37661/1816-0301-2021-18-4-17-25</mixed-citation></citation-alternatives></ref><ref id="cit4"><label>4</label><citation-alternatives><mixed-citation xml:lang="ru">Lui, C. DNS and BIND / C. Lui, P. Albitz. – 5th ed. – O'Reilly Media, Inc., 2006. – 642 р.</mixed-citation><mixed-citation xml:lang="en">Lui C., Albitz P. DNS and BIND, 5th edition. O'Reilly Media, Inc., 2006, 642 р.</mixed-citation></citation-alternatives></ref><ref id="cit5"><label>5</label><citation-alternatives><mixed-citation xml:lang="ru">Построение и исследование распределенной информационной системы веб-приложений и сервисов на базе кластерной архитектуры / В. А. Старых [и др.] // Качество. Инновации. Образование. – 2011. – № 12. – С. 91–99.</mixed-citation><mixed-citation xml:lang="en">Starykh V., Varyonov D., Ploskov S., Kuznetsov A. Construction and research of a distributed information system of web applications and services based on cluster architecture. Kachestvo. Innovacii. Obrazovanie [Quality. Innovation. Education], 2011, no. 12, рр. 91–99 (In Russ.).</mixed-citation></citation-alternatives></ref><ref id="cit6"><label>6</label><citation-alternatives><mixed-citation xml:lang="ru">A survey of general-purpose computation on graphics hardware / J. D. Owens [et al.] // Computer Graphics Forum. – 2007. – Vol. 26, no. 1. – Р. 80–113.</mixed-citation><mixed-citation xml:lang="en">Owens J. D., Luebke D., Govindaraju N., Harris M., Kr˝uger J., …, Purcell T. J. A survey of generalpurpose computation on graphics hardware. Computer Graphics Forum, 2007, vol. 26, no. 1, рр. 80–113.</mixed-citation></citation-alternatives></ref><ref id="cit7"><label>7</label><citation-alternatives><mixed-citation xml:lang="ru">Dongarra, J. J. The LINPACK benchmark: Past, present and future / J. J. Dongarra, P. Luszczek, A. Petitet // Concurrency and Computation: Practice and Experience. – 2003. – Vol. 15, no. 9. – Р. 803–820.</mixed-citation><mixed-citation xml:lang="en">Dongarra J. J., Luszczek P., Petitet A. The LINPACK benchmark: Past, present and future. Concurrency and Computation: Practice and Experience, 2003, vol. 15, no. 9, рр. 803–820.</mixed-citation></citation-alternatives></ref><ref id="cit8"><label>8</label><citation-alternatives><mixed-citation xml:lang="ru">High Performance Computing: Technology, Methods and Applications / J. Dongarra [et al.]. – Inc., 2015. – 444 p.</mixed-citation><mixed-citation xml:lang="en">Dongarra J., Grandinetti L., Joubert G. R., Kowalik J. High Performance Computing: Technology, Methods and Applications. Inc., 2015, 444 p.</mixed-citation></citation-alternatives></ref><ref id="cit9"><label>9</label><citation-alternatives><mixed-citation xml:lang="ru">Dongarra, J. Adaptive linear solvers and eigensolvers / J. Dongarra // Argonne Training Program on Extreme-Scale Computing. – 2016. – Mode of access: https://extremecomputingtraining.anl.gov/files/2016/08/Dongara_830_AdaptiveLinear.pdf. – Date of аccess: 08.08.2022.</mixed-citation><mixed-citation xml:lang="en">Dongarra J. Adaptive linear solvers and eigensolvers. Argonne Training Program on Extreme-Scale Computing, 2016. Available at: https://extremecomputingtraining.anl.gov/files/2016/08/Dongara_830_ AdaptiveLinear.pdf (аccessed 08.08.2022).</mixed-citation></citation-alternatives></ref></ref-list><fn-group><fn fn-type="conflict"><p>The authors declare that there are no conflicts of interest present.</p></fn></fn-group></back></article>
